Output 96bec1763343c7d604b46cf727ffc1c3d40b2781b71169203d9113ee3764cb02:1

value
57579023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1869027d67804791151e7a324a42206bcfa19ed0 OP_EQUAL
address
MA8EFEkBtqh8hKdv6RswJeSztnyDVqbWT9
transaction
96bec1763343c7d604b46cf727ffc1c3d40b2781b71169203d9113ee3764cb02
spent
true